NEW YORK (PIX11) – Bronx Congressman Ritchie Torres (D-NY) introduced the TRUMP Act on Friday.
The TRUMP Act, which stands for The Restrict Ugly Money Portraits Act, aims to prohibit any president from issuing currency with their own likeness and requires U.S. currency to only feature deceased individuals.
“America’s money should only feature big, beautiful faces—not big, ugly faces,” said Rep. Torres in a statement.
The legislation is a response to a design for a new $1 coin that honors America’s 250th birthday and features President Trump.
The design, which features Trump standing in front of an American flag with his fist clenched, was confirmed by United States Treasurer Brandon Beach.
